Monday, May 04, 2009

Software Engineer-- J2EE, Hibernate, Oracle in New York, NY

Monday, May 04, 2009
Our client is a high-visibility television production company seeking an applications developer to create and maintain systems to support the organization's business functions. This role will work closely with users to complete the analysis, design, coding, testing and implementation of those systems. Responsibilities include: Developing and maintaining architecturally sound, modular, component-driven applications Driving the analysis and design of software systems by shaping system requirements and developing analysis-level documents that reflect the requirements Demonstrating leadership capabilities by providing direction to and mentoring for less experienced members of the staff Maintaining system and design documentation, and preparing materials for project reviews Implementation, UAT (User Acceptance Testing) and production release phases of project Adhering to company software development life-cycle processes and documentation of business processes and systems Serving as point of contact between IT and clients, and between groups within IT Experience: 3+ years Java development experience (design and coding) 1+ years Spring/Hibernate experience 2+years SQL and entity relationship modeling (Oracle Preferred) experience 2+years Application Server (WebLogic preferred) experience 1+years Web Frameworks, JSP or, Swing (Spring Webflows preferred) experience Some experience with Ant / Ant Maker / CVS 1+years IDE experience 1+years Rose (or some UML tool) experience Self starter with the ability to multi-task and assess priority Strong ability to adapt to evolving business needs Experience in analysis, design and development (coding) of client/server business applications Strong understanding of standard software development lifecycle methodologies Strong understanding of all aspects of corporate software development; strong client, server, database, and reporting skills Knowledge of and experience with Analysis and Design Patterns Experience using UML (Unified Modeling Language) Experience in making presentations, with the proven ability to present complex ideas clearly and persuasively Experience in data migration between systems and work flows a plus Experience with entertainment-oriented business systems a plus To Apply to this job go to http://www.GadBall.com or click here